Meaning of refrain
- To hold back; to restrain; to keep within prescribed bounds; to curb; to govern.
- To abstain from
- To keep one's self from action or interference; to hold aloof; to forbear; to abstain.
- The burden of a song; a phrase or verse which recurs at the end of each of the separate stanzas or divisions of a poetic composition.
